Selangor, 3 December 2025 – Myra, the residential brand of Oriental Interest Bhd, has launched Myra Senja in Subang 2 with a game-changing partnership with Panasonic Malaysia. Every open-market unit in the three-tower development will come standard with essential energy-efficient appliances: four inverter air-conditioners, electric water heaters, a 90-cm induction hob and T-shape hood. Larger four-bedroom units will also receive a front-loading washer-dryer and multi-door refrigerator as part of a limited-time offer.
Spanning 1,101 to 1,409 sq ft and priced from RM658,000 to RM988,200, Myra Senja targets young families and upgraders with low-density living (only 12 units per floor), family-centric facilities and ground-floor retail.
